SINA Corporation (NASDAQ: SINA) is a leading online media company and value-added information service (VAS) provider for China and for Chinese communities worldwide. With a branded network of localized websites targeting Greater China and overseas Chinese, SINA provides services through five major business lines including SINA.com (online news and content), SINA Mobile (mobile value-added services), SINA Online (community-based services and games), SINA.net (search and enterprise services) and SINA E-commerce (online shopping), offering Internet users and government and business clients an array of services including online media and entertainment, online fee-based VAS/wireless VAS, and e-commerce and enterprise e-solutions.
With 230 million registered users worldwide, 450 million daily page views and over 60 million active users for a variety of fee-based services, SINA is the most recognized Internet brand name in China and among Chinese communities globally.
In various surveys and polls, SINA has been recognized as the most valuable brand and the most popular website in China. For 2003 and 2005, SINA was ranked the "Most Preferred Website" in China according to the Chinese Academy of Social Sciences and considered "The Most Respected Chinese Company" for three consecutive years in 2003, 2004 and 2005 by the Economic Observer and the Management Case Study Center of Beijing University. At the same time, South China Weekend in both 2003 and 2004 honored SINA with the prestigious award of the "Chinese Language Medium of the Year."
